Re: new heliums w/retread tires on ma eg (YokohamaSiR)
yes, it is a tire that has a new tread section "glued" on to it. As they wear out, the tread will separate and you wind up with big sections of rubber flying all over your car. Semi's use retreads cuz they're cheaper. that's why you see huge sections of rubber on the road. That's from a retread separation.
edit: my best friend bought retreads once. the tire separated on him at 80 mph and destroyed his passenger side mirror and scratched his paint all to hell.
